How long does a truck Regen take? Truck regenerations take approximately twenty to sixty minutes, depending on the type of regen, the amount of build-up, and engine type. An exchange-traded fu...The truck senses this and goes into a "regen". This occurs when the truck dumps extra amount of fuel into the cylinders on one side of the engine to raise EGTs to 1000 degrees. This basically incinerates all of the particulate matter in the filter, which goes out the tailpipe. An exchange-traded fu...How Long Does Regen Take? Regen times depend on the soot level, vehicle condition, and type: Passive regen – Average of 5-10 minutes; Active regen – Typically 10-30 minutes ; Parked regen – Can take over an hour if DPF is overloaded; Long or frequent regens usually indicate a potential problem.
